dc.description.abstractThe sol-gel technique was used to synthesize Er2-xCoxO3 (0.0 <= x <= 0.30) mixed oxides to analyze structural and magnetic properties. The Rietveld analyses show that Er2-xCoxO3 nanoparticles up to x = 0.1 have single phase, for x >= 0.2 Co3O4 phase appears. Preferential cationic distribution between the non-equivalent sites 8b and 24d is found for all samples. A systematic variation is found in the average maximum strain with composition x. The magnetic analysis showed that super-paramagnetism is the reason of S-shaped hysteresis loops and also non-zero magnetic moments. Both Mr and Ms increased with increasing concentration of Co+2.en_US
